    Talentbridge is partnered with a local manufacturing team with focus on innovative technologies and are seeking a skilled and experienced Manufacturing Engineer specializing in Machining, CNC, and assembly processes. The ideal candidate will be responsible for overseeing the production processes, ensuring efficiency, quality, and timely delivery of products. The role requires expertise in CNC programming, machining operations, and assembly processes. You will collaborate closely with the manufacturing team to optimize production workflows, troubleshoot issues, and implement process improvements to enhance productivity and product quality.

    Key Responsibilities:

    • Develop and optimize CNC programs for machining operations.
    • Oversee machining processes, including milling, turning, drilling, and grinding.
    • Fabricate prototype design for manufacturability
    • Monitor machining parameters to ensure compliance with quality standards.
    • Troubleshoot machining issues and implement corrective actions as needed.
    • Work across all teams for resolution related to non-conforming materials.
    • Previous experience related to NPI and discontinuing of older product would be ideal.
    • Identify opportunities for process improvements to enhance productivity and efficiency.
    Qualifications:
    • Bachelor degree in Mechanical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, or related field.
    • Proficiency in CNC programming and operation.
    • Strong knowledge of machining processes, including milling, turning, and grinding.
    • Experience with assembly processes and equipment.
    • Familiarity with CAD/CAM software (e.g., SolidWorks, AutoCAD).
    • Exc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ail.
    • Knowledge of lean manufacturing principles and continuous improvement methodologies is a plus.
